LeBron James has inscribed himself in NBA history once again, establishing the mark for the most regular-season games played in the league’s history as the Los Angeles Lakers achieved an exciting 105-104 victory over the Orlando Magic. The 41-year-old attained the achievement in his 1,612th appearance, exceeding Robert Parish’s previous record of 1,611 games set in 1997. In a thrilling conclusion, Luke Kennard’s three-pointer with just 0.6 seconds remaining sealed the triumph for the Lakers, who prolonged their winning run to nine consecutive games. James recorded 12 points, six rebounds, four assists and three steals in the contest, pursuing his outstanding 23rd consecutive NBA season and solidifying his place as one of basketball’s greatest ironmen.

Durant enters exclusive scoring company

Kevin Durant contributed further milestones to his storied legacy on the identical night, surpassing Michael Jordan to claim 5th position on the NBA’s lifetime regular season scoring rankings. The Houston Rockets forward, who tallied 27 points in his team’s narrow 123-122 win over the Miami Heat, achieved this feat with a three-point shot during the fourth quarter. Durant’s 32,294 career points now put him two ahead of Jordan, among the sport’s all-time greats, cementing his status among the sport’s elite scoring talents and underscoring his exceptional durability across an extended playing career.

The achievement constitutes a significant individual landmark for Durant, who acknowledged thanks for the opportunity to remain competitive at the top echelon. “It means a lot,” he said in the aftermath of the Rockets’ dramatic last-gasp victory. “I’m appreciative to be here and for this remarkable experience it’s been. I’m looking forward to continuing.” With the Rockets sitting in fourth place in the West, Durant remains focused on collective achievement whilst quietly accumulating point tallies that rank him among basketball’s all-time greats. Pandemonium unfolds in Thunder’s dominant display

The Oklahoma City Thunder’s commanding 132-111 win against the Washington Wizards was marred by a heated altercation that saw four players sent off from the match. In a large-scale fight towards the conclusion of the second quarter, tensions boiled over as the reigning NBA champions demonstrated their superiority on court. The Thunder’s Ajay Mitchell, Jaylin Williams and Cason Wallace were all ejected, whilst Washington’s Justin Champagnie was ejected following the fiery confrontation. In spite of the disciplinary chaos, Oklahoma City’s greater attacking prowess proved to be the difference.

Shai Gilgeous-Alexander was the leading contributor for the Thunder, delivering a stellar 40-point display that underscored his team’s offensive capabilities. The reigning title holders occupy the summit of the Western Conference standings, holding their spot as the league’s strongest outfit. Meanwhile, the Wizards’ difficulties mount, occupying 14th place in the Eastern Conference with their season unravelling.
